879560-15-3,879560-18-6,879560-19-7,908270-34-8,908271-33-0,138535-06-5 Supplier | KPCMS.IN
CMO CDMO service. KPCMS.IN supply 879560-15-3,879560-18-6,879560-19-7,908270-34-8,908271-33-0,138535-06-5 and related compounds.
138535-06-5 908270-34-8 879560-15-3 908271-33-0 879560-19-7 879560-18-6